Let’s take a closer look at how Porsche is utilizing AI to enhance battery performance and safety in their electric cars. Recently, in a press release, Porsche shared their cutting-edge approach to monitoring battery health using artificial intelligence. They highlighted two key areas of focus: predictive quality assurance and anomaly detection.
Predictive quality assurance is essentially about leveraging data to forecast how a battery will age over time. Imagine being able to compare notes from all users to gather insights that could inform you about your battery’s future. This isn’t just a vague estimate; it could mean a reality where you have a clearer picture of what to expect from your EV as it matures.
Even more impressive is the capability to detect anomalies within the battery system. This is crucial because it can potentially catch an issue before it escalates into something more serious. Think about it: with the right alerts sent directly to your smartphone via the owner’s app, you could avoid dangerous situations, like a thermal runaway—where a glitch in one battery cell could lead to a catastrophic failure in others.
While Porsche’s release doesn’t explicitly mention thermal runaway, the implications are there. It’s a concern that looms over the EV industry, and having tech that can monitor battery health at such a granular level provides much-needed reassurance.
